All-Inclusive retreat: Punta Cana, Dominican Republic

Choosing an all-inclusive resort gives you a head start on your short break. Booking is stress-free, and you can relax poolside right after checking in, with diverse dining and activities at your doorstep. Zemi Miches Punta Cana All-Inclusive Resort, Curio Collection by Hilton sits in a perfect location on Playa Esmeralda beach with the beautiful Redonda Mountains as your backdrop. Elevate your stay by booking Club Azure accommodations, which offer extra perks like access to an exclusive rooftop pool and the Royal Palm Lounge. For in-resort dining, grab a table at Toa, where Caribbean cuisine is served up with a modern twist. Make the most of your short stay by asking the concierge to help plan your itinerary with activities that range from paddleboarding and yoga to exciting off-site excursions before winding down at the Acana Spa.

City escape: Dallas

Enjoy an urban spring break weekend in Dallas by booking a hotel that has makes it easy to explore all of the city’s top attractions. The centrally located Hilton Garden Inn Downtown Dallas is surrounded by shops, bars, and restaurants, plus offers easy access to the nearby DART transport network, simplifying your adventures around the city. There’s plenty of culture to experience, too, with the Dallas Museum of Art and Majestic Theater within walking distance. From the rooftop pool to the 24-hour fitness center and the friendly, knowledgeable staff willing to help plan your stay, your spring break vacation begins as soon as you walk into the spacious lobby. The hotel’s atmospheric Elm Street Cask & Kitchen has around 150 bottles of whiskey and features delicious, locally inspired dishes, or you can experience Texan hospitality in the refined Bourbon Lounge bar.

Sun-filled retreat: Orlando, Florida

Booking a spring break vacation in Florida’s capital of fun means you’re guaranteed an unforgettable stay. Combine serious relaxation with major attractions when you check in at Hilton Orlando. Make travel easier with the hotel’s complimentary transportation to top sites, plus its convenient location just minutes from International Drive, so you can maximize the fun with quick commutes to theme parks, mega shopping malls, and outdoor adventures. When you’re not out exploring, keep busy at the hotel's water slides, tennis courts, and lazy river. If you’re planning a pool day, book a cabana for added privacy or head to the full-service eforea Spa to access a comprehensive menu of wellness, beauty, and salon treatments. When it comes to dining, choose from six on-site eateries. Sports bar FastBreak celebrates all-American favorites, with beers on tap, or enjoy Italian classics at Trabucco.
